Transaction 50077df163ed02151b5256b46dc3389bedaaf085a3383e28674b049787bff346
1 Input
2 Outputs
- 50077df163ed02151b5256b46dc3389bedaaf085a3383e28674b049787bff346:0
- 50077df163ed02151b5256b46dc3389bedaaf085a3383e28674b049787bff346:1
value 950000
address 3MForezcpZXK28xDCXqoxEX64uCPhHu5qk
value 570000
address 37R1dU9xtPED4fXncbKsnAfLCmhpB72ycc